calmissile Posted January 29, 2008 Posted January 29, 2008 I purchased the pro version of DVBViewer for use with my Technotrend S2=3200. Also purchsed a S2-3650 CI (USB) unit and would like to use DVBViewer with it as well. Does viewer support the S2-3650 CI and if not, is there a plan to add it to the hardware list? Quote
CiNcH Posted January 29, 2008 Posted January 29, 2008 (edited) Already supported... You only need an up-to-date ttBdaDrvApi_Dll.dll within the DVBViewer folder... Announcement Edited January 29, 2008 by CiNcH Quote

Well, this is enough frustration for a day. I uninstalled DVBViewer and reinstalled DVBViewer Pro 3.9.10 from scratch. 1st time was my mistake. I did not have an internet connection and the program installs anyway (without the added components). I selected all options on the install menu and then selected the following components A. CI Support for Technotrend B. X86 MS VC Runtime Libraries for Technotrend C. Technotrend Remote V1.1.A D. Webserver Control. In order to make the test as simple as possible I connected my working LNB for Nimik 1 from another receiver directly to the Technotrend S2-3650 CI. No switches selected. I am unable to scan for channels and see any response. Also, the LED does not turn from Red to Green while scanning. When I use TT-Media Center, the lamp changes from Red to Green and the signal levels are good. Obviously I am doing something wrong but need to take a break before I pull my hair out. I don't have a transponder list for North America so that I can try entering the parameters manually and try that. Will look for one on the Web. The date of the ttBdaDrvapi_Dll.dll file installed is 11/15/2007 I also installed the vcredist_x86.exe file that I downloaded from your link. There must be something in the configuration that I have set wrong. Any more advice is appreciated.
